    Everyone gave you the right answer . . . the Dressed Down have less embellies and mixed media. I used to make the photo sizes smaller as well, but after repeated requests to keep the same photo size, I've stopped doing that. It's easy enough for the scrapper to reduce as they prefer without sacrificing the pixels/quality that you get when you size up.
